2010 Census Information The next Complete Count Committee (CCC) meeting will be held Thursday, Feb. 18, 2010,  at 2 p.m. in the Commissioners' boardroom at 203 W. Broughton St. In 2000, the year of the last census, only 58 percent of the county's citizens were counted, which resulted in the county being ineligible for its share of more than $300 billion in Federal grants. We ask that citizens click on the link above to learn more about the census or call 229-248-3030 and speak to CCC member Barbara Parsons for more information. All census information is confidential and is not given to any other agency, so citizens are encouraged to please report all household members accurately when they receive their 10-question census form.

Decatur County’s old landfill on Fowlstown Road is open Wednesdays and Saturdays from 7 a.m. until 5 p.m. Bagged household garbage is accepted for $1 per bag up to $5 per load for anything less than 400 pounds. Call the old landfill phone number at 246-3488 for more information. The new landfill located off Hwy. 27 South is open six days per week with hours Monday through Friday being 8 a.m. until 5 p.m., and on Saturday 8 a.m. until noon, phone 465-3188.

The Golden Triangle RCDC has a Household Water Well System Loan Program for low income home owners who need to replace or repair existing wells in Baker, Calhoun, Clay, Decatur, Dougherty, Early, Grady, Miller, Mitchell, Randolph, Seminole and Terrell counties, not available for new construction. Call 229-723-3841 for more information.
